Output 63fd2928268cf954e190b11125b0228a1fabf5e0b9b1b4fb14d086ff3878dbaf:0

value
1652956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a5c091fb84b692e625ee6cf7ad5d409ea42d22 OP_EQUAL
address
39E1twW9mK6kRw8nnbJEwQ792gTbuZXr4T
transaction
63fd2928268cf954e190b11125b0228a1fabf5e0b9b1b4fb14d086ff3878dbaf
spent
true